Review of The Conformist (1971) by Amy D — 21 Dec 2007
I am not as impressed with this film as I wanted to be. It's widely acclaimed by filmmakers, but the actual story isn't very deep at all. The cinematography is great, but the light and dark contrasts are overdone. The so-called "interesting" examination of sexuality is so shallow it hurts.
This film is by no means bad. In fact, it's well done and makes for good viewing. My only complaint is that so many people think this is the greatest film of all time whenever there are so many better, edgier films that actually have more mature things to say.
